    Of the various logos that I have seen for the Shark Punching Center, the most famous alternate-reality take on the SCP Foundation, this is IMO the absolute definitive one:

    It really captures the absurdity and badassery of an universe where the Foundation's every activity somehow involves the noble art of "selachian pugilism".

    Now, back to the main Foundation universe. Or rather, my version of it.

    In addition to the steampunk Cogwork Orthodox Church and the web-enthusiast Church of Maxwellism, there is a third denomination within the Church of the Broken God. This one is called the School of the Cage Perennial.

    It was created by defectors from the other groups, who joined the Foundation without renouncing their personal faith in the Broken God. They adopted a new core belief, that seeking and confining the anomalous is the best way to honor Mekhane's sacrifice, when the god turned his own chest into a great brass cage to imprison Yaldabaoth. They have been particularly active in Foundation projects involving the automation of containment procedures, such as the Artificial Intelligence Applications Division.

    Some have denounced the School as an obvious and inexplicably successful attempt by the Church to infiltrate the Foundation. Others have pushed the theory that the Foundation actually began as a Mekhanite sect, and that the real SCP-001 may even be the Cage itself.

    It's an oldie, but a goldie; the Samus Aran (of Metroid fame) trans headcanon!

    The headcanon:
    • She was recently out (or at the very least openly questioning her gender) as a child on with zero stigma on K-2L (since it's the future, and transphobia is long dead). Hence why her hair has the look of short hair that's seen some resistance to having it cut shorter again (my own hair looked similar when I was growing out an egg haircut).
    • This was the reason Old Bird struck up a conversation with her (the Chozo, being a nearly extinct race who live for centuries, probably know about gender incongruence but don't have much experience with it).
    • Her medical records weren't updated prior to the space pirate attack. While the Chozo probably filled in a few forms here and there when they made contact with the federation, this muddled up paperwork would explain why some people are under the impression, in universe, that she's a man (or a robot, or a myth) until they're corrected (I can attest that a few dusty old records not being uptodate here and there can do this) despite her being the federation's "champion" prior to Fusion.
    • She was probably able to transition without a problem when she was growing up with the Chozo, but would have faced some issues (thanks to the aforementioned paperwork issues) after joining the police/military/whatever (the canon here isn't clear thanks to translation issues).
    • This also explains why she wears a full face of makeup when she's alone in her ship (she probably wasn't allowed before) and relaxes in that outfit in one of the unlockable images in Fusion.


    Meta text interpretations:
    • She's of course the poster child (and on TVT, the trope namer) for Samus is a Girl. Aside from the obvious, getting misgendered because of an assumption that an unidentified person is male is one of the lesser known effects of transmisogyny.
    • As you may have heard, she was referred to with a word for trans people that may or may not have been a transphobic slur by one of the Super Metroid devs (there's a massive wall of arguments about the state of LGBTQ rights in Japan and what the word means that I'm nowhere near qualified to talk about). Either way, it was probably a joke, but...no takebacksies (unless Nintendo come out and say she's cisgender, which is even more unlikely than canonically making her trans)!
    • In the course of the series she's been modified with both Chozo and Metroid DNA. Transhumanism (not to be confused with one another despite using the same prefix, mind you) and trans rights have often been connected (medical transitions are a low key form of transhumanism; the idea of "morphological autonomy" vibes with a lot of trans folk; some people even - jokingly - argue that how a cyberpunk setting deals with trans people is a good way to decide how good its worldbuilding is).

    Related to the video game CARRION.

    CARRION is an experimental weapon from DNA discovered that was originally from something out of the equivalent of the far realms.

    It's project name is C.A.R.R.I.O.N.
    Consumptive
    Adaptative
    Rapid Reshaping
    Intelligent
    Organic
    Nemesis

    The original escaped from...
    Spoiler: Endgame Spoiler
    Show

    ... the container below where you start the game.


    It actually has the ability to undergo supernatural evolutions. It was supposed to fight rebels underground as a living weapon. Then when it's task was completed, a special chemical compound would be released to kill it. Unfortunately, it's ability to undergo evolutions beyond what is naturally possible granted it resistance to the compound. The weapons used against it heavily incorporate the compound in their functionality. That's why a metal mine cart falling on CARRION does no damage to it. It is supernaturally tough.

    When you save, and in particular load, CARRION is sending its memory backwards in time. That's why all your progress is reset. This is also possibly partially responsible for its escape.

    When CARRION eats someone, even part of them perhaps, it gains all of their intelligence and knowledge. This is how it can operate a nuclear reactor 5 minutes after seeing it for the first time.

    CARRION isn't malevolent (At least in my playthrough I avoided eating unarmed humans in almost every case). It's trying to escape the torturous experimentation that would be done to it (and was done to it).
